Who Was George Ellery Hale?
George Ellery Hale was born in 1868 and grew to become one of the most influential astronomers of his time. He founded several major observatories, including the famous Mount Wilson Observatory, which played a crucial role in advancing our understanding of the universe. Hale was not just a scientist; he was also a visionary who recognized the importance of collaboration in scientific research.

The Founding of Mount Wilson Observatory
In 1904, Hale established the Mount Wilson Observatory, a pivotal moment for both Pasadena and astronomy. This facility allowed astronomers to conduct groundbreaking research, including the discovery of the expanding universe. The observatory became a center for innovation, attracting top scientists and fostering a collaborative spirit that was essential for scientific advancement.
Innovations in Telescope Design
Hale was instrumental in the development of larger and more powerful telescopes, revolutionizing how we observe the cosmos. His work on the 60-inch and later the 100-inch telescope at Mount Wilson set new standards for astronomical research. These innovations opened up new possibilities in our understanding of celestial bodies and phenomena.

Hale's Impact on Astrophysics
One of Hale's significant contributions to science was his research on solar phenomena. His studies on sunspots and solar magnetic fields advanced our understanding of the sun's behavior and its impact on Earth. This work was foundational for the field of astrophysics and remains relevant to this day.
Building a Scientific Community
Hale believed in the power of collaboration and education, which led him to establish institutions that encouraged scientific inquiry. He played a key role in founding the California Institute of Technology (Caltech), which has since become a world-renowned institution. Through his efforts, Hale fostered a vibrant scientific community in Pasadena, inspiring future generations of scientists.
